No-Limit Texas Hold’em Poker- Who is Phil Ivey?

Phil Ivey has been referred to as the greatest poker contender on the globe by quite a few of the top pros. Phil Ivey was born in Riverside, CA and moved to New Jersey before his first birthday. His grandfather taught him penny-ante 5-Card Stud poker. From that point on, he was hooked on poker and wanted to discover anything he could about poker. Phil routinely told his parents that he wanted to be a professional poker player. He didn’t let the adverse feedback from others annihilate his ambition of being one of the greatest poker players on the planet.

Phil began competing intently after getting a false ID by the name of Jerome. He honed his game at the casinos of Atlantic City. The first few years for Phil were a teaching experience and coming away with a win was not a normal thing at the time. Phil made his mark at the 2000 World Series of Poker when he made 2 final tables and won his first WSOP bracelet, in a $2, five hundred Pot-Limit Omaha game. At the closing table he defeated a number of the better known pros which includes "Amarillo Slim" Preston, David "Devilfish" Ulliot, and Phil Hellmuth, Jr.

Phil decided to take his skills to the successive level and moved out west to Sin City. He continues to play in "The Big Game" at the Bellagio with the best players in the world. Phil credits his achievements to dedication and an immeasurable passion for the game of poker. He says that he is learning every single day and is quite humble about his success. He knows he makes mistakes every single game of poker and constantly strives to improve.

Although Ivey has come first in some big-time tournaments, he favors winning money games on a regular basis.
